      Mrs. Marshall T. Hayes, Sabine Parish, Sabine Index, Many, LA, Mar 28,1941

      28 Mar 1941 - Last rites for Mrs. Marshall T. Hayes, age 68 years, wereheld at Warren Baptist church last Wednesday at 2 p.m., Rev. W. B.Valentine officiating. Dennis-Green funeral home directing, intermentWarren cemetery.

      Surviving are husband, Mashall T. Hayes; children, Mrs. Tim Oxley, Mrs.R. H. McComic, Jeff and S. B. Hayes of Many, Mrs. J. W. Oxley of Alco,Mrs. Clyde Bell of Silsbee, Texas, Mrs. J. C. Blackman, Mrs. GilbertBlackman, Ed., Lee, Rufus and Theodore Hayes of Fisher. She is alsosurvived by 29 grandchildren; two brothers, George and Jessie Byrd; foursisters, Misses Julia and Emma Byrd of Vowell's Mill, Mrs. Nathan Rhodesof Provencal and Mrs. J. H. Paul of Many and a host of nieces and nephews.
